Also try to use every loss as a learning experience! It's a good idea to save battle videos of games you lost as you can look back on them and try and find turns that you made mistakes in, and how you could've played them better.
Being able to make good predictions is also incredibly important and the best way of getting better at that is by playing more and learning to understand your opponents better!
You're not going to get into the 1800s straight away, but the more you play the better you'll get!
